Walter Morgan, Nepicar Brewery, London Road, Wrotham, Kent.

Founded by Jonathon Biggs at the Spring Tavern c.1840. He later moved to Strood leaving the Nepicar Brewery under the control of his two sons.

Upon their father's death they too moved to Strood and brewery sold to C.G.& J.M.Reed.

Morgan assumed control c.1880.

Brewery purchased 1905 for its retail license by Golding & Co. of Sevenoaks.

Brewing ceased c.1912 and brewery demolished.
